Bipolar Disorder therapists in Madison, Alabama Statistics
Bipolar Disorder therapists in Madison, Alabama average 18 years of experience and charge around $211 per session. 100% offer online sessions. The top treatment approaches are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) (79%), Psychodynamic Therapy (43%), and Behavioral Therapy (40%).
